- How was wastewater treated in China in the 1970s?
- In the early 1970s, wastewater treatment in China was mostly accomplished through the renovation of natural terrains such as abandoned rivers, depressions, and marshes, as well as establishing stabilization ponds to perform simple primary wastewater treatment .
- Why did wastewater treatment plants change in China after 2000?
- Due to a rise in the labor, location rent, and management costs in the eastern region, the industrial manufacturing industry gradually moved to the central and western areas after 2000, resulting in a change in the wastewater treatment plants and capacity in various regions of China, which can be illustrated by Fig. 2.
